The Human Animal Bond Research Institute (HABRI) and Freshpet, a fresh pet food brand, have announced a partnership to advance their shared goal of strengthening the human-animal bond through research, education and advocacy.

“At Freshpet, we believe that pets are family, and they deserve the very best nutrition to help them thrive,” said Billy Cyr, Freshpet’s CEO. “Our mission is to elevate the way we feed our pets with fresh food that nourishes all. By partnering with HABRI, we’re excited to support research that underscores the vital role pets play in our lives.”

Research has shown a connection between the health of pet parents and the health of their pets. Good nutrition plays a vital role, with pet parents who have strong human-animal bonds being more likely to provide high-quality nutrition for their pets, noted Freshpet. These strong bonds with our pets are also linked to improved mental and physical health.

“Understanding and promoting the connection between the wellbeing of people and pets is a shared mission for both Freshpet and HABRI,” said Steven Feldman, president of HABRI.
